Understanding Seasonal Turnover
Seasonal turnover refers to the predictable increase in staff departures or absences during certain times of the year. Common causes include:
- Flu season and illness-related absences
- Vacation periods during summer or holidays
- Temporary relocation or seasonal employment changes
- Burnout from high patient loads during peak periods
These shifts can strain existing staff, increase overtime costs, and impact patient satisfaction.
Strategies to Minimize Seasonal Turnover
1. Flexible Staffing Solutions
Partnering with a nursing staffing agency allows facilities to quickly adjust staffing levels according to seasonal demands. Temporary RNs, LPNs, and CNAs can fill gaps without compromising care quality.
2. Proactive Scheduling
Planning schedules in advance and accommodating vacation requests early helps reduce conflicts and prevent burnout. Consider implementing rotating shifts or part-time options during peak periods.
3. Retention Incentives
Offer seasonal bonuses, recognition programs, or additional paid time off to motivate staff to stay during high-demand periods. Feeling valued can significantly reduce turnover.
4. Cross-Training Staff
Encourage team members to learn multiple roles within the facility. Cross-trained staff can step in when needed, ensuring smooth operations even during absences.
5. Monitor Workload and Morale
Regular check-ins and feedback sessions help identify burnout or stress early. A supportive work environment encourages staff to stay, even during busy seasons.
